12 Mar Progressive Values Meet Union Artistry at Schnuck’s Market Bakery

From a single, small confectionery in 1939, Schnuckβs Markets, Inc. has grown into a leading regional supermarket chain with 115 stores in Missouri, Illinois, Indiana and Wisconsin.
BCTGM Local 4 (St. Louis, Mo.) members at Schnuckβs Market Bakery in St. Louis are behind the cakes and other sweet goods that get shipped to the chainβs retail grocery stores for sale.
βOur members not only bake the cakes in this facility, they elaborately decorate them,β says Midwest Region BCTGM International Representative Jason Davis.
Davis accompanied Local 4 Financial Secretary/Business Manager Josh Camden for a service visit to the bakery in January. According to Davis, Schnuckβs was ramping up its production of King Cakes to prepare for Mardi Gras. βThe work that goes on here is highly specialized and takes considerable artistic talents,β he added.

According to Camden, progressive values may be at the heart of that artistic skill. βSchnucks was recognized as one of Americaβs Greatest Workplaces for Diversity by Newsweek last year,β Camden points out. βYou can see that when looking around the bakery, but also in the unique, quality products the Union bakers put out.β
In addition to creative seasonal items, the Local 4 members at Schnuckβs put out a daily supply of muffins and other sweet goods for sale across the companyβs Midwest retail stores.
